DTC 31, 32, 33, 34 Speed Sensor Circuit
CIRCUIT DESCRIPTION
The speed sensor detects the wheel speed and sends the ap-
propriate signals to the ECU. These signals are used to control
the ABS control system. The front and rear rotors each have 48
serrations.
When the rotos rotate, the magnetic field emitted by the perma-
nent magnet in the speed sensor generates an AC voltage.
Since the frequency of this AC voltage changes in direct propor-
tion to the speed of the rotor, the frequency is used by the ECU
to detect the speed of each wheel.
DTC No.DTC Detecting ConditionTrouble Area
31,32,33,34
Detection of any of conditions (1) through (3):
(1) At vehicle speed of 10 km/h (6 mph) or more, pulses are
not input for 15 sec.
(2) Momentary interruption of the vehicle speed sensor signal
occurs at least 7 times in the time between switching the igni-
tion switch ON and switching it OFF.
(3) Abnormal fluctuation of speed sensor signals with the ve-
hicle speed 20 km/h (12 mph) or more.
Right front, left front, right rear and left rear speed sensor
Open or short in each speed sensor circuit
Sensor rotor
HINT:
DTC No.31 is for the right front speed sensor.
DTC No.32 is for the left front speed sensor.
DTC No.33 is for the right rear speed sensor.
DTC No.34 is for the left rear speed sensor.
Fail safe function:
If trouble occurs in the speed sensor circuit, the ECU cuts off current to the ABS solenoid relay and prohibits
ABS control.

INSPECTION PROCEDURE
1 Check speed sensor.
Front
PREPARATION:
(a) Remove front fender splash shield.
(b) Disconnect speed sensor connector.
CHECK:
Measure resistance between terminals 1 and 2 of speed sensor
connector.
OK:
Resistance: 0.6 - 2.5 kW
CHECK:
Measure resistance between terminals 1 and 2 of speed sensor
connector and body ground.
OK:
Resistance: 1 MW or higher
CHECK:
Check the sensor connector.
OK:
(1) There is not play on the connector connecting
part.
(2) Connectors are connected each other securely.

DTC 41 IG Power Source Circuit
CIRCUIT DESCRIPTION
This is the power source for the ECU, hence the CPU and the actuators.
DTC No.DTC Detecting ConditionTrouble Area
41Voltage at ECU terminal IG1 is less than 9.5 V for more than
10 sec. while vehicle speed is 3 km/h (1.9 mph) or more.Battery
IC regulator
Open or short in power source circuit
Fail safe function:
If trouble occurs in the power source circuit, the ECU cuts off current to the ABS solenoid relay and prohibits
ABS control.
